Mysterious Circumstances Surrounding the Death of Celeste Rivas Hernandez
The murder case of 14-year-old Celeste Rivas Hernandez has left many unanswered questions, as the Los Angeles County Department of Medical Examiner has sealed details regarding her death. Her remains were discovered last year in the trunk of a Tesla that had been impounded, sending shockwaves through her hometown of Lake Elsinore.
Rivas was reported missing two years ago, and her disappearance ultimately led to disturbing revelations when her body was found in a vehicle linked to popular TikTok singer David Burke, known professionally as "D4vd." Burke, 21, was arrested seven months after the remains were uncovered at a Los Angeles tow yard.
As of Sunday, Burke remains in custody without bail, awaiting a court appearance where he may learn if charges will be pursued against him by the District Attorney’s office.
Timeline of Events
- April 2024: Rivas, a seventh grader, was last seen on April 5 while heading to a movie with Burke, whom her family acknowledged she knew.
- August 5, 2025: D4vd commenced his "Withered" tour in Del Mar.
- Late August or Early September 2025: A Tesla Model Y was abandoned and subsequently impounded in a Hollywood Hills neighborhood.
- September 8, 2025: Tow yard employees discovered a strong odor emanating from the Tesla, leading to the horrifying discovery of human remains inside. Police located a decomposed head, torso, and severed limbs, spurring a death investigation.
On the same day, D4vd was performing in Minneapolis as part of his tour.
September 9, 2025: It was confirmed that the Tesla was registered to D4vd, and his representatives stated he was cooperating with law enforcement.
September 16, 2025: Law enforcement identified the remains as those of Celeste Rivas Hernandez, just a day after what would have been her 15th birthday.
September 17, 2025: Investigators conducted a search of a rental property in Hollywood Hills linked to D4vd, looking for evidence related to the case.
September 19, 2025: Following the ongoing investigation, the singer canceled the remainder of his U.S. tour dates.
September 21, 2025: A vigil was held in Lake Elsinore to honor Rivas and support her family. Local community members expressed their desire for justice.
November 18, 2025: Authorities named D4vd a suspect, revealing he had not been fully cooperative as had previously been claimed, and indicating that investigators believed he had assistance in the body’s dismemberment and disposal.
November 21, 2025: Information regarding the specifics of Rivas’ death was sealed by a court order, with the Medical Examiner’s office stating that details about the cause and manner of death would remain confidential.
February 2026: Prosecutors sought testimony from D4vd’s family as part of the ongoing investigation, which faced attempts to block their enforcement from a Texas court.
April 16, 2026: D4vd was arrested based on a probable cause warrant but has not yet been charged. He remains in custody, with his legal team asserting his innocence.
Attorneys for Burke declared: “Let us be clear — the actual evidence in this case will show that David Burke did not murder Celeste Rivas Hernandez and he was not the cause of her death," insisting that no indictment or criminal complaint has been filed against him.
The court appearance set for Monday will be pivotal in determining the progression of the case.
